Looking at overall running costs, both models reveal some interesting differences in everyday economy.
Kia EV9 is substantially cheaper – starting at 54,200 £ , while the Jaguar I-Pace costs 79,200 £ . That’s a price difference of around 25,038 £.
In terms of energy consumption, the Kia EV9 is noticeably more efficient: consuming 19.5 kWh/100km compared to 25.2 kWh/100km for the Jaguar I-Pace. That’s a difference of about 5.7 kWh/100km.
As for electric range, the Kia EV9 offers moderately more range – reaching up to 563 km, about 94 km more than the Jaguar I-Pace.
Power, torque and acceleration are the classic benchmarks for car enthusiasts – and here, some clear differences start to show.
When it comes to engine power, the Kia EV9 offers noticeably more power – delivering 508 HP compared to 400 HP. That’s roughly 108 HP more horsepower.
When accelerating from 0 to 100 km/h, the Kia EV9 is barely quicker – completing the sprint in 4.6 s, while the Jaguar I-Pace takes 4.8 s. That’s about 0.2 s quicker.
There’s also a difference in torque: the Kia EV9 delivers barely more torque with 740 Nm compared to 696 Nm. That’s about 44 Nm more.
Beyond pure performance, interior space and usability matter most in daily life. This is where you see which car is more practical and versatile.
Seats: Kia EV9 offers more seats – 7 vs 5.
In terms of curb weight, Jaguar I-Pace is marginally lighter – 2,226 kg compared to 2,392 kg. The difference is around 166 kg.
Looking at boot space, the Jaguar I-Pace offers clearly more boot space – 638 L compared to 333 L. That’s a difference of about 305 L.
When it comes to payload, the Kia EV9 carries visibly more – 615 kg compared to 444 kg. That’s a difference of about 171 kg.
The Kia EV9 holds a decisive overall lead in the objective data comparison.
